We are looking for an Ad Product Programmer to support the development, optimization, and evolution of rich media advertising formats and internal production tools.
This role focuses on building and adapting interactive ad formats across multiple ad networks, while also creating, improving, and maintaining internal tools that support the teamβs production workflows. The position contributes to improving delivery speed, technical stability, and reducing reliance on external production partners.
The developer will collaborate with Product, Producers, QA teams and external partners to ensure efficient, scalable, and high-quality delivery of interactive advertising formats.
Scope:
β’ Create and adapt rich media formats for several networks (GAM, Gameloft, DV360) using JavaScript, ensuring accurate tracking and seamless data flow.
β’ Architect, code, and test new ad formats and integrations for new networks.
β’ Troubleshoot and resolve complex, cross-functional issues related to ad delivery, tracking, and client-side errors.
β’ Develop and maintain robust internal systems supporting the creation, testing, and deployment of ad formats.
β’ Build, update, and maintain internal tools used for format production, automation, debugging, and QA workflows.
β’ Fix bugs and stability issues in current internal tools and development pipelines.
β’ Optimize code and assets to comply with strict ad size and performance constraints.
β’ Ensure proper tracking, documentation, and knowledge sharing of technical issues and solutions.
β’ Collaborate with internal teams and external partners to maintain quality standards and technical alignment.
